OSWEGO, IL — Students graduating high school who are pursuing a degree in higher education this fall are eligible to receive a $500 scholarship from the Oswego Fire Protection District. Two "outstanding seniors" from Oswego High School and Oswego East High School will be chosen to receive $500 scholarships "in honor of the dedicated leadership and service of all members of our fire district both past & present," officials said in a news release Wednesday. The fire district awards two scholarships each year, and the 2022 application period is open until 3 p.m. April 22. The scholarships are meant for students to use at an institution of higher learning. Officials said the application process is simple, but here are a few things to keep in mind when applying, according to scholarship guidelines: Preference is given to applications pursuing a degree in fire science or a related field. Students pursuing public safety will also be given preference, but it's weighed less than the fire science field.Students can only receive this scholarship once.Scholarships awarded are contingent on the availability of qualified applicants.Applicants who don't include a transcript and a one-page essay won't be considered. To pick up an application, people interested can visit Oswego Fire Station #1 at 3511 Woolley Road in Oswego. Applications and additional guidelines can be found on the fire district's website.
